Questions & Answers
The cheapest way to get from Amherst to Windsor is to drive which costs $7 - $11 and takes 58 min.
The fastest way to get from Amherst to Windsor is to drive which takes 58 min and costs $7 - $11.
No, there is no direct bus from Amherst to Windsor. However, there are services departing from Amherst Center and arriving at Central St @ Broad St via Hartford Union Station and Central Row South Side @ Travelers.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 2h 27m.
The distance between Amherst and Windsor is 46 miles. The road distance is 39.5 miles.
The best way to get from Amherst to Windsor without a car is to bus and train via Springfield which takes 2h 10m and costs $11 - $28.
It takes approximately 2h 10m to get from Amherst to Windsor, including transfers.
Amherst to Windsor bus services, operated by Peter Pan Bus Lines, depart from Amherst Center station.
Amherst to Windsor bus services, operated by Peter Pan Bus Lines, arrive at Hartford station.
Yes, the driving distance between Amherst to Windsor is 39 miles. It takes approximately 58 min to drive from Amherst to Windsor.
